Output d3e6ee65c4686591487ecafae0d6acac792d888199564f970bd77f852affdee5:27

value
37645346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81d836c5c7e8edb0a0e5935cc25a5e1a3233fff OP_EQUAL
address
3NrL3g1nF4mF3SiLpWCTxtE91hroCtBfdP
transaction
d3e6ee65c4686591487ecafae0d6acac792d888199564f970bd77f852affdee5